So let's talk about the packaging first. The cream comes inside a solid plastic pot. I don't mind the plastic material instead of typical glass pot because the plastic is a solid one and not filmsy at all. The pot is quite deep though which surprises me because usually eye creams come in 10-15 ml tiny tube. The overall packaging design represents the brand Innisfree very well. I got the impression that Innisfree is a 'green' and nature brand.
The eye cream has rich creamy consistency and applies very nicely. It sinks directly into the skin and leaves the skin hydrated and moisturized. It stings a little little bit upon application but it doesn't bother me at all. I also notice that the area under my eyes feel 'tighter' afterwards. I've been using this eye cream this past 3 weeks and I must say I am very happy with it so far.
It preps my under eye area and makes concealer applies smoothly and prevents it from creasing.

According to the description on the packaging, the cream is supposed to deliver moisture and nourishment to your eye area so I must say it does the job very well.
